This week is the last week before Autodesk University. Thousands are heading for Las Vegas in the next few days and we will be ready for them with great speakers, classes, technology, Innovation forums, vendors, AUGI Annual meeting, entertainment and more. In this final week before AU, I am head down for my sessions and events by trying to avoid email to prevent distraction. In addition to the last week push and cramming, it is a short week in the U.S. with the Thanksgiving holiday. I will begin my annual AU live blogging & Twitter updates next Sunday complete with photos as attendees begin to arrive and some of the behind the scenes as Autodesk University is being setup. Then as AU starts there will be daily updates, highlights, and photos as I attempt to go without sleep and cover as much of the event as humanly possible. If this is your first AU, definitely make sure to attend the AU Freshman Orientation Monday, November 26, 5:00 p.m.–6:00 p.m and also learn about those of us that are AU Mentors to help you make the most of the AU experience. This is my 15th year of Autodesk University events, and the number 22 I have attended and presented at if my AU counting is right as there were multiple AUs in some years and some overseas. Each AU event is unique and I can’t wait to experience AU 2012, and then directly afterwards get some well needed rest and recovery. Hope to see you at AU! Cheers, Shaan
